Grey

Description

  • Offered Name: “Grey”
  • Birth Name: Jarlath Eleutherius
  • Gender: Male
  • Age: 20, Birthdate: Kesendaar 1st, 4356
  • Hair color: Silver, shaven bald (to obscure the exotic coloration)
  • Eye color: Gray
  • Height: 5'10”
  • Weight: 170lbs

Background

Jarlath was never known as a very exceptional child. He was not bright, he was not athletic, and he certainly was not memorable. In the rare event that he was the topic of conversation, words like “reliable” and “quiet” were used.

His father, Caius Ardin Eleutherius, was a modest blacksmith who also dabbled in jewelcraft. Marina Solana, Caius' wife and a passable cook, was betrothed to Jarlath's father in an apparently unremarkable prearrangement, just as both of their own parents had been. The Eleutherius clan had always participated in the tradition of arranged marriages; it was both a familial as well as a religious tradition passed down from before even the eldest of them could recall.

In truth, the bloodlines of Jarlath's ancestors had been carefully constructed for over 4500 years. An offshoot cult of Echnis, the spirit of technology, had laid a convoluted and intricate eugenics program that began in the Year of the Fulcrum when it became apparent that the power of technology had been eclipsed by the power of magic. Using impossibly complex statistical calculations and applying magically-integrated chaos theory (read: Fate magic), the cult's efforts not only assisted in the manifestation of Echnis but also insured that one day the spirit would have a mortal (re)incarnation if needed.

Jarlath is not the ultimate fruit of that endeavor; he is one generation removed from the culmination. Jarlath's essence has been constructed to house an unprecedented affinity for the four physical elements of Air, Fire, Earth, and Water (read: Matter and Forces). The missing ingredient, embodied by his predestined mate, comprises of a font of raw Magic (read: Prime and Fate) bred from both angelic and demonic bloodlines. By design, the offspring of Jarlath and that woman would be the perfect host for a god-become-flesh.

The identity of this woman is kept secret, just as Jarlath's was, and in fact great pains were made to insure that both of their lives were otherwise kept as bland as possible. In no way should they have ever experienced anything extraordinary, as such things tend to derail long-term schemes. The very individuals themselves, the ordained parents of a supernatural entity, were even mentally conditioned to exhibit very little personality of their own. After all, it would not be useful if the tools of destiny exercised very much free will.

When the slavers came to Traubin, Jarlath was old enough to understand what was happening, yet not old enough to fight back. His parents, on the other hand, fought back with surprising tenacity, and paid for their bravery with their lives. Realizing that he was powerless to make a difference and that his only hope of survival was to simply withstand the cruelty and hardship of the slavers, Jarlath grew into a man of incredible fortitude. He learned to endure, and in enduring, grow stronger.

Even more devastating to Jarlath's originally intended destiny, the secret members of the cult of Echnis assigned to watch over him ended up dying in a futile attempt to keep him from expressing his latent magical abilities. Now all that remains of that organization consists of a remote cell in an unknown village, tending to Jarlath's intended mate, and they do not have the resources to easily safeguard the female as well as track down Jarlath himself.

The cult do not even have a current physical description of the boy, and they certainly are unaware that his magical awakening turned his hair from black into gleaming silver. Additionally, to honor his rebirth as a free man (and/or mystic being) and as a constant personal reminder of his orphanhood, Jarlath dropped his given name entirely and now answers only to “Grey.”

Apparently there were a few ancient variables which were not properly taken into account.
